K. Miyahara is a scholar working on Surgery, Materials Chemistry and Mechanical Engineering. According to data from OpenAlex, K. Miyahara has authored 59 papers receiving a total of 822 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Surgery, 16 papers in Materials Chemistry and 14 papers in Mechanical Engineering. Recurrent topics in K. Miyahara’s work include Cardiac and Coronary Surgery Techniques (15 papers), Materials Challenges in Fusion Energy Research (13 papers) and Hydrogen embrittlement and corrosion behaviors in metals (9 papers). K. Miyahara is often cited by papers focused on Cardiac and Coronary Surgery Techniques (15 papers), Materials Challenges in Fusion Energy Research (13 papers) and Hydrogen embrittlement and corrosion behaviors in metals (9 papers). K. Miyahara collaborates with scholars based in Japan, United States and Belgium. K. Miyahara's co-authors include P.J. Maziasz, Ick Soo Kim, Naoyuki Hashimoto, David J. Larson, L. Heatherly, D. Hoelzer, R.L. Klueh, E. A. Kenik, Akio Matsuura and N. Igata and has published in prestigious journals such as Journal of Catalysis, Journal of Thoracic and Cardiovascular Surgery and Scripta Materialia.
